86 <sect2 role="installation">
87 <title>Installation of Fcron</title>
88
89 <note>
90 <para>
91 Systemd logging daemon, systemd-journald will automatically log
92 all the messages from the services started by systemd.
93 </para>
94 </note>
95
96 <para>For security reasons, an unprivileged user and group for
97 <application>Fcron</application> should be created (perform as the
98 <systemitem class='username'>root</systemitem> user):</para>
99
100<screen role="root"><userinput>groupadd -g 22 fcron &amp;&amp;
101useradd -d /dev/null -c "Fcron User" -g fcron -s /bin/false -u 22 fcron</userinput></screen>
102
103 <para>Install <application>Fcron</application> by running the following
104 commands:</para>
105
106<screen><userinput>./configure --prefix=/usr --sysconfdir=/etc \
107 --localstatedir=/var --without-sendmail --with-boot-install=no &amp;&amp;
108make</userinput></screen>
109
110 <para>This package does not come with a test suite.</para>
111
112 <para>Now, as the <systemitem class="username">root</systemitem> user:</para>
113
114<screen role="root"><userinput>make install</userinput></screen>
115
116 <para>DESTDIR install must be done as <systemitem class="username">root</systemitem> user.</para>
117

120 <sect2 role="commands">
121 <title>Command Explanations</title>
122<!--
123 <para><command>autoconf</command>: This command is required to rebuild
124 <filename>configure</filename> using the fixed input file.</para>-->
125
126 <para><parameter>--without-sendmail</parameter>: By default,
127 <application>Fcron</application> will attempt to use the
128 <command>sendmail</command> command from an <xref linkend="server-mail"/>
129 package to email you the results of the <command>fcron</command> script.
130 This switch is used to disable default email notification. Omit the switch
131 to enable the default. Alternatively, you can use the
132 <option>--with-sendmail=<replaceable>&lt;/path/to/MTA
133 command&gt;</replaceable></option> to use a different mailer command.</para>
134
135 <para><parameter>--with-boot-install=no</parameter>: This prevents installation
136 of the bootscript included with the package.</para>
137
138 <para><option>--with-editor=<replaceable>&lt;/path/to/editor&gt;</replaceable></option>:
139 This switch allows you to set the default text editor.</para>
